Every year my local swimming pool advertises a swimming challenge in aid of the local council chair's favoured good cause, and this year that cause is Yorkshire Air Ambulance. The challenge is to swim 6, 12, 24 or 32 miles (or 384, 768, 1536 or 2048 lengths of the local pool). I'm going for the 32, which is a bit daunting, but hey, that's what challenges are for, right?

It costs £12,000 per day to keep the Yorkshire Air Ambulance running - if I can raise £250, that helps for half an hour. It's a service I'm very glad we have but I hope never to need. 

As with all my previous posts on this subject, while my breast stroke is fine, I *still* can't swim crawl, so this is all going to be done in breast stroke. Think on that and weep, all ye water-borne speed demons!
